Wife and I stopped in for lunch, I ordered the grouper sandwich blackened with a side of coleslaw and wife had Atlantic haddock fish and chips. Beautiful outdoor seating, somewhat reasonably priced, sunny 65 degree February at noon what’s not to love!
Service was perfect, grouper sandwich cooked perfectly, very tender. Had sandwich on brioche bun with their tartar sauce, onion tomato and lettuce. Very fresh but messy. Cole slaw as a side also very good but nothing to write home about.
Wife had fish and chips and I would order this dish myself if we returned. Very flaky haddock, a little greasy as to be expected but 3 large pieces. She got the fries with it which were good but not great.
I do think if you’re having a drink or 2 and taking a break from the beach this is perfect. We biked up and had water so I think a drink or 2 is where this establishment will shine. Pretty good value on siesta key. Enjoy!

SKOB!!! Everything about this place is fun. They have live music every day and the bands are always great. The place is ultra casual and shorts and flip flops will do. The food is consistently good and bartenders serve up fabulous cocktails. Tonight the “baby shark tank” (see pics) stole the show. But we went for the oysters which we seemed to have overdosed on last year. They didn’t last long enough for me to take a pic…next time. From 3-6pm they sell them for $12 a dozen. You don’t have a choice of the oyster type, but they are decent for the price. Everything on the menu is good, but I particularly like the scallops and fish tacos. There can be a wait for a bar seat or table especially in season and they typically stay busy all day long.
